    When reports began to emerge that the latest Flash Player update to version 11.3.300.257 was causing the Firefox browser to freeze or crash, I started to investigate the matter. Firefox users who upgrade their version of Flash to the latest official version may experience crashes and freezes in the browser, sometimes in rapid succession. They basically make the browser unusable to work with.

    I was using Firefox 13.0.1 with Adobe Flash Player 11.3.300.257 and when I watched youtube videos, Firefox or Adobe Flash Plugin would crash sometimes. I thought this was normal because ever since maybe Firefox 3.6 Firefox and Adobe Flash Plugin would crash a lot. But just now youtube videos were constantly getting Adobe Flash Plugin errors so I updated the Adobe Flash Player from 11.3.300.257 to 11.3.300.262 and now youtube videos seem to be playing okay without errors.
